Joseph Peyraud, Dated 1904, Painting, Military Scene, Colonial Army, Cochinchina War
Artist: Joseph Peyraud
Large painting depicting a military scene featuring artillerymen of the French colonial army operating the famous 80mm cannon. One of the gunners has just been hit and collapses in the arms of his superior. Severed heads belonging to "the enemy" can be seen hanging from a tree in the upper left corner of the canvas. This scene likely takes place during the colonization of Cochinchina (present-day South Vietnam) or Tonkin (present-day North Vietnam). This painting would benefit from cleaning; yellowish stains are visible. This oil on canvas is signed in the lower right corner by Joseph Peyraud and dated 1904. It is sold unframed.
